Thanks I tried that. I am not sure what else to do. The last message I see when trying to load the browser is:

Requesting IP address of www.codemii.com
IP of www.codemii.com successfully retrieved.

Then Read error 116 occurred. Retrying...

Then it stops and does nothing else.

I updated homebrew channel to latest version and then it installed the browser.

The WAD file-format is a file-format that contains information for the wii, such as System Menus, IOSs, and Channels.
